How to prepare for a job interview at Academics Ltd
✨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you’re familiar with the CACHE Level 3 qualification and how it applies to the role. Brush up on child development theories and practices, as well as any relevant legislation. This will show your passion and commitment to the wellbeing of young children.
✨Show Your Personality
Nursery roles are all about connection and care. Be yourself during the interview! Share your experiences working with children and how you’ve made a positive impact in their lives. This helps the interviewer see how you’d fit into their supportive environment.
✨Ask Thoughtful Questions
Prepare some questions that show your interest in the school’s approach to early years education. Ask about their methods for supporting child development or how they ensure a nurturing atmosphere. This demonstrates your enthusiasm for the role and your desire to contribute positively.
